TisIBP8, a fungal‐derived hyperactive ice‐binding protein, helps Caenorhabditis elegans survive dehydration. It localizes near cell membranes, reduces cell damage, and helps maintain membrane structure during drying. These results suggest that ice‐binding proteins can protect cells from dehydration stress as well as freezing stress.

Hyperosmotic stress triggers the relocation of the CFIm complex from the nucleus to the cytoplasm. This shift creates a nuclear ‘stoichiometric bottleneck’, limiting CFIm availability for mRNA processing. Preparation of the Electrospun Composite Nanofibers for Oils Absorption.
Abstract In this study, polymeric materials that absorb oils floating on the surface of the water, such as paraffin oil, engine oil, and transmission oil, were prepared by electrospinning. The sorbent comprises Polyvinyl chloride (PVC)/polystyrene (PS) nanofibers. The blend nanofibers were strengthened by (2.5,3.5.4.5, and 5.5) wt.% of Zirconia.

Sorption Capacity of New Type Oil Absorption Felt for Potential Application to Ocean Oil Spill
A new type of oil absorption felt (NOAF-1) with high adsorption capacity, expected to be applied in ocean oil spill, was designed. The NOAF-1 was fabricated with commercial oil absorption felt (OAF) and expanded graphite (EG).
